The distance from Dillenburg to Augsburg is approximately 201 miles (324 km).
The average frequency per day from Dillenburg to Augsburg is:
- Around 13 trains per day.
- Around 3 buses per day.
However, we recommend checking specific travel dates for your route between Dillenburg and Augsburg as scheduled services by can vary by season or day of the week.
These are the most popular departure and arrival points from Dillenburg to Augsburg:
- Buses mostly depart from Siegen, Koblenzer Str. and arrive in Augsburg, Biberbachstraße (P + R Augsburg North).
- Trains mostly depart from Dillenburg station and arrive in Augsburg Hbf.

Most travelers need at least three days in Augsburg to see the main sights at a comfortable pace. If you want day trips or a slower itinerary, consider adding extra time.
In Augsburg, you can explore the Maximilian Museum to learn about the city's history and craftsmanship, wander through the Botanical Garden Augsburg, and visit the unique collection at the Augsburg Puppet Theatre Museum. Discover the historic Lech canals that have shaped the city or enjoy a performance at the Augsburg State Theatre. Don't miss visiting the Augsburg Cathedral with its stunning Gothic architecture, the historic Fuggerei, the Renaissance-style Augsburg Town Hall, the panoramic views from Perlach Tower, and the family-friendly Augsburg Zoo.
Augsburg can be explored in 2 to 3 days, allowing enough time to visit its historic sites, museums, and enjoy local cuisine.
